Overview

Engage in a thought-provoking debate on hackers, media, truth, trust, and alternative facts from the Hack in Paris conference. Explore the value proposition of truth, fact-checking challenges in anonymous online claims, and the dilemma of exposing technical vulnerabilities without verification. Delve into discussions on rumors, political agendas, fake technical news, government transparency, and the role of the hacker community. Examine the ethics of disclosing bugs, errors, and security flaws, and consider the impact of forensics firms on trust. Participate in this interactive session, bringing your questions and opinions to challenge the panel of experts, including Michael Masucci, Deral Heiland, and Annie Machon, with Winn Schwartau as moderator.
